Output 65010f080e318324a2676ed9003863885643a2962ee757c90b8a575b71ad9642:24

value
399990
script pubkey
OP_0 OP_PUSHBYTES_20 2b46c73b76e482a11ce3635eb1f9985843a3a3bd
address
bc1q9drvwwmkujp2z88rvd0tr7vctpp68gaahmpu9l
transaction
65010f080e318324a2676ed9003863885643a2962ee757c90b8a575b71ad9642
confirmations
270759
spent
true